Transaction 34b08642fe4555144bb39351703a840b7ebc70a194384c45a9fc5787cd081c75
1 Input
2 Outputs
- 34b08642fe4555144bb39351703a840b7ebc70a194384c45a9fc5787cd081c75:0
- 34b08642fe4555144bb39351703a840b7ebc70a194384c45a9fc5787cd081c75:1
value 195480
address 1PmQrMEsJNeL4AzeHoJZVHUSMLtYQV6p37
value 1909524
address 1KMZuDPvAoWP8tNr5NR5uyR2uGJeYeQT9M